basically yes. You could say that I always use this combo but sometimes just in different variations because the class is best to be played in freestyle. The structure of popping addons, debuffing mobs and buffing myself stays pretty much the same everytime, after that you mostly have to track your cd's in order to see what you can use. Tracking cd's is very important at spots like crypt where you have really tanky mobs and can't use the same skills for every pack of mobs.

you cannot use a pve combo in pvp - for a pvp combo it comes down to cc's and protections depending on the situation not straight damage - it's a whole different story. I would recommend looking up a video that explains the basic cc mechanics and learn a combo off of an other guide or ninja discord. A very crucial part of playing a class like ninja is to track cd's and combo accordingly from that skills you still have available because you will use a lot of "combo skills" in your neutral game/movement until you are able to get a catch. This will take a lot of time and practice to master
